Catarina Santos Silva has a PhD in Biomedical Engineering by Universidade do Minho. She also completed the Integrated Master's in Bioengineering by Faculdade de Engenharia Universidade do Porto. Published 8 articles in journals. Organized 2 event(s). Has received 3 awards and/or honors. Works in the area(s) of Engineering and Technology with emphasis on Materials Engineering, Biological Sciences with emphasis on Cell Biology, Medical Biotechnology with emphasis on Biomaterials, Medical Biotechnology with emphasis on Health-Related Biotechnology, Medical and Health Sciences with emphasis on Basic Medicine with emphasis on Immunology and Medical and Health Sciences with emphasis on Basic Medicine with emphasis on Neurosciences. In her professional activities, she has interacted with over 20 authors in a scientific context.
